Chapter 6: Adolescence – A Stage of Growth and Change

Definitions:

Adolescence: Adolescence is the stage of life between childhood and adulthood when rapid physical and mental changes occur.

Puberty: Puberty is the stage during adolescence when the body becomes capable of reproduction.

Hormone: Hormones are chemical substances produced by glands that control various body functions.

Endocrine Glands: Endocrine glands are glands that secrete hormones directly into the bloodstream.

Growth Hormone: Growth hormone is a hormone responsible for increase in height and overall body growth.

Testosterone: Testosterone is a male hormone responsible for development of male characteristics.

Estrogen: Estrogen is a female hormone responsible for development of female characteristics.

Menstruation: Menstruation is the monthly cycle in females in which the lining of the uterus is shed.

Balanced Diet: A balanced diet is a diet that contains all essential nutrients in proper amounts.

Personal Hygiene: Personal hygiene refers to keeping the body clean and maintaining good health habits.


Quick Revision Points:

  • Adolescence is a stage of rapid growth and development.
  • Puberty marks the beginning of reproductive maturity.
  • Hormones control physical and emotional changes.
  • Boys and girls develop different characteristics.
  • Emotional changes are normal during adolescence.
  • Menstruation is a natural process in females.
  • Balanced diet is important for proper growth.
  • Personal hygiene helps prevent infections.
  • Regular exercise and sleep are important.
  • Changes during adolescence are natural and normal.
